    Space for real life, not just a vase

    People rarely buy a large console table just for show. It ends up taking keys, sunglasses, dog leads, parcels you’ve not opened yet, and that plant you keep meaning to repot. The difference between a good one and a bad one is how it responds to that. A good console feels solid when you lean on it, doesn’t wobble when someone brushes past, and has proportions that don’t make it feel like a barricade. Drawers that open without sticking, shelves that don’t bow under a stack of books, finishes that don’t sulk if you set down a damp bag — that’s what makes these worth living with.

    Eye-catching large console tables that are expertly crafted

    With bigger console pieces, you feel the quality the first time you nudge them. They should sit square on the floor, no rocking, no hollow rattle if you tap the side. Tops need to feel reassuring under a heavy lamp or a stack of hardbacks, not give you that “is this wise?” moment. Surfaces here are chosen to shrug off daily use: a mug put down without a coaster, a bag slid along the edge, a bunch of flowers that drip a bit. Edges feel friendly to the touch, not sharp or tinny, and there’s a believable weight when you move them. It’s the kind of piece you stop noticing because it just quietly does its job well.
